Pertanyaan yang diberi tag «internals»

4
Bagaimana bcrypt memiliki garam bawaan?
Artikel Coda Hale "Cara Aman Menyimpan Kata Sandi" mengklaim bahwa: bcrypt memiliki garam bawaan untuk mencegah serangan tabel pelangi. Dia mengutip makalah ini , yang mengatakan bahwa dalam implementasi OpenBSD tentang bcrypt: OpenBSD menghasilkan garam bcrypt 128-bit dari stream kunci arcfour (arc4random (3)), diunggulkan dengan data acak yang dikumpulkan kernel …


10
Mengapa menggunakan metode publik di kelas internal?
Ada banyak kode di salah satu proyek kami yang terlihat seperti ini: internal static class Extensions { public static string AddFoo(this string s) { if (s == null) { return "Foo"; } return $({s}Foo); } } Apakah ada alasan eksplisit untuk melakukan hal ini selain "lebih mudah untuk membuat tipe …
250 c#  scope  public  internals 

7
Bagaimana cara kerja debugger?
Saya terus bertanya-tanya bagaimana cara kerja debugger? Khususnya yang bisa 'dilampirkan' agar sudah bisa dieksekusi. Saya mengerti bahwa kompiler menerjemahkan kode ke bahasa mesin, tetapi kemudian bagaimana debugger 'tahu' apa yang dilampirkan?

7
Faktor di R: lebih dari sekadar gangguan?
Salah satu tipe data dasar di R adalah faktor. Dalam pengalaman saya, faktor-faktor pada dasarnya menyakitkan dan saya tidak pernah menggunakannya. Saya selalu mengonversi ke karakter. Saya merasa aneh seperti saya melewatkan sesuatu. Adakah beberapa contoh penting dari fungsi yang menggunakan faktor sebagai variabel pengelompokan di mana tipe data faktor …

2
Pemagangan string Python
Meskipun pertanyaan ini tidak memiliki kegunaan nyata dalam praktiknya, saya ingin tahu bagaimana Python melakukan interning string. Saya telah memperhatikan yang berikut ini. >>> "string" is "string" True Ini seperti yang saya harapkan. Anda juga bisa melakukan ini. >>> "strin"+"g" is "string" True Dan itu sangat pintar! Tapi Anda tidak …
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.